Do I need a passport to go to Cancun?

All Americans traveling to Cancun must have a valid US passport when flying to Mexico, available from the US Department of State (travel.state.gov). A passport or passport card is accepted for travelers driving from the United States to Cancun or for those arriving by cruise ship or other watercraft.

Where to avoid when traveling to Mexico by plane?

You should fly into Mexico to avoid international land border crossings, especially along the border with the United States in the cities of Tijuana, Ciudad Juárez, Nuevo Laredo and Reynosa. When crossing an international land border: remain extremely vigilant
